Ir para conteúdo
Fórum Script Brasil
  • 0

(Resolvido) Multiplicar a parte Details, tem como?


BStar

Pergunta

Bom dia a todos... La vem eu com mais alguma duvida :D e nem sei se é bem isso que quero fazer mais vamos lá...

Como dividir a parte de Section Detail em 4 resultado diferentes?

Vamos ver se eu consigo exemplificar...

Tenho Vários códigos que podem ser de 4 tipos com suas respectivas amarrações e valores...

Tipo...

cod1   tipo  tem valor x   desconto y   valor total z
 qtde        
 10      1     $20               $5          $15 

cod2    tipo   tem valor x   desconto y   valor total z
 qtde         
 20       3     $50               $5          $45

cod3  tipo    tem valor x   desconto y   valor total z
qtde        
 10       1      $10              $2            $8 

cod4   tipo    tem valor x   desconto y   valor total z
 qtde       
 100     4      $1000         $100          $900
Atualmente, quando faço uma consulta no meu relatório, eu trago o resultado geral... Tipo:
cod1     tem valor x   desconto y    valor total z
qtde     
140          $1080         $112           $968
O que eu queria fazer, era exatamente como está no primeiro exemplo, mas repetindo o código pela quantidade de tipo que ele possui... Nesse caso, 4 vezes! Algo como: Linha 1 (ou datails1): select cod, tipo, valor, desconto, total from produto where produto = 1 and tipo = 1 Linha 2 (ou datails2): select cod, tipo, valor, desconto, total from produto where produto = 1 and tipo = 2 Linha 3 (ou datails3): select cod, tipo, valor, desconto, total from produto where produto = 1 and tipo = 3 Linha 4 (ou datails4): select cod, tipo, valor, desconto, total from produto where produto = 1 and tipo = 4 Dessa forma, no Crystal ficaria algo como:
cod1   tipo  tem valor x   desconto y   valor total z
 qtde        
 10      1     $20               $5          $15 

cod1    tipo   tem valor x   desconto y   valor total z
 qtde         
 20       2     $50               $5          $45

cod1  tipo    tem valor x   desconto y   valor total z
qtde        
 10       3      $10              $2            $8 

cod1   tipo    tem valor x   desconto y   valor total z
 qtde       
 100     4      $1000         $100          $900

Outro ex:

Linha 1 (ou datails1): select cod, tipo, valor, desconto, total from produto where produto = 2 and tipo = 1

Linha 2 (ou datails2): select cod, tipo, valor, desconto, total from produto where produto = 2 and tipo = 2

Linha 3 (ou datails3): select cod, tipo, valor, desconto, total from produto where produto = 2 and tipo = 3

Linha 4 (ou datails4): select cod, tipo, valor, desconto, total from produto where produto = 2 and tipo = 4

O meu parâmetro que vou passar pela a aplicação é o Código. Quando eu entrar com o código X (1, 2, 3, 4 ...), eu queria que ele me "listasse" esse código com os seus quatro tipos possíveis (se houver)

Sei que pelo Report Viewer é mais simples de fazer... Mas como a o restante dos relatórios eu fiz com o Crystal, eu gostaria de continuar usando ele... mesmo porque, acho o Layout do Crystal melhor....

Desde de já o meu muito obrigado e se ficou faltando alguma informação, é só avisar...

Abraço!

Editado por BStar
Link para o comentário
Compartilhar em outros sites

1 resposta a esta questão

Posts Recomendados

  • 0

Então galera... Estava dando uma pesquisada, e aprendi que posso jogar as minhas consultas SQL no Crystal também através do Commad.

Na hora de criar o relatório, abaixo da conexão que iremos usar, tem uma opção "Add Command", é só dar dois cliques ali, e logo em seguida jogar a consulta SQL dentro do campo que aparece e pronto...

Depois disso é só usar os campos que nos criamos pelo Command... O resto das formulas podem ser feitas pelo Crystal mesmo :D

Mais uma vez obrigado.

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,3k
    • Posts
      652,5k
×
×
  • Criar Novo...